Listing Rules on Capital Raisings by Listed Issuers Tightened by HKEx
Amended Listing Rules disallow rights issues, open offers and specific mandate placings, individually or when aggregated within a rolling 12-month period, that result in a cumulative material value dilution

Hong Kong Monetary Authority to Launch Pilot Bond Grant Scheme
On 10 May 2018, HKMA issued a circular setting out details of the highly anticipated three-year Pilot Bond Grant Scheme

New Rules for Listing Biotech Companies on Hong Kong Stock Exchange
The Hong Kong Stock Exchange (the Exchange) published its Consultation Conclusions on a Listing Regime for Companies from Emerging and Innovative Sectors on 24 April 2018 (Consultation Conclusions)

SFC and CSRC increase daily quotas for Mainland-Hong Kong stock connect
The new daily quotas will take effect on 1 May 2018 and will increase the daily quota for each of the Shanghai-Hong Kong and Shenzhen-Hong Kong Stock Connect schemes.
Continued deficiencies in sponsor work identified by SFC
The said deficiencies were especially common for sponsor work done for GEM IPOs. Between October 2013 and December 2017, 44 listing applications were returned or rejected due to concerns raised during the vetting process.
